当前位置:首页 » 编程语言 » c语言三个数求最小值
扩展阅读
webinf下怎么引入js 2023-08-31 21:54:13
堡垒机怎么打开web 2023-08-31 21:54:11

c语言三个数求最小值

发布时间: 2022-01-30 12:36:01

㈠ 计算三个整数的最小值。 c语言

#include<stdio.h>
#include<stdlib.h>
intgetmin(int*s,intn)
{
inti;
intmin;
min=s[0];
for(i=0;i<n;i++)
if(s[i]<min)
min=s[i];
returnmin;

}
voidmain()
{
ints[100][3];
inti,n,j;
printf("inputn:");
scanf("%d",&n);
for(i=0;i<n;i++)
for(j=0;j<3;j++)
scanf("%d",&s[i][j]);
for(i=0;i<n;i++)
{
printf("minis%d ",getmin(s[i],3));
}

}

㈡ 如何用C语言编程求三个数中的最小值

#include<stdio.h>

intmain()
{
intx,y,z;
scanf("%d,%d,%d",&x,&y,&z);
intmin=x;//假设x为最小数
if(y<min)min=y;
if(z<min)min=z;
printf("最小数是:%d ",min);
return0;
}

㈢ c语言 求三个数中最大值和最小值的差值

直接上代码吧,相信应该能看懂的。
main(){
int a,b,c,min,max;
scanf("%d%d%d",&a,&b,&c);
min=a;if(b<min)min=b;if(c<min)min=c;
max=a;if(b>max)max=b;if(c>max)max=c;
printf("三个数中最大值和最小值的差值为:",max-min);
}

㈣ c语言如何求三个数a,b,c的最大值

c里没有and这种东西,写作&&

if(a>=b && a>=c) z=a;

if(b>=a && b>=c) z=b;

if(c>=a && c>=b) z=c;

return z;

例如:

void main()

{

int a,b,c,p,max;

printf("请输入a,b,c三个数字::");

scanf("%d %d %d",a,b,c);

if(a>b)

p=a;

else

p=b;

if(p<c)

max=c;

printf("最大值为:max=%d",max);

(4)c语言三个数求最小值扩展阅读:

C的数据类型包括:整型(short,int,long,long long)、字符型(char)、实型或浮点型(单精度float和双精度double)、枚举类型(enum)、数组类型、结构体类型(struct)、共用体类型(union)、指针类型和空类型(void)。

变量是以某标识符为名字,其值可以改变的量。标识符是以字母或下划线开头的一串由字母、数字或下划线构成的序列,请注意第一个字符必须为字母或下划线,否则为不合法的变量名。变量在编译时为其分配相应存储单元。

㈤ c语言编写一个程序,求三个数中最小值,要求带参宏实现

#include<stdio.h>
#defineMIN(x,y)(x>y?y:x)
voidmain()
{
inta=1,b=2,c=3,min;
min=MIN(MIN(a,b),c);
printf("%d ",min);
}

㈥ 用c语言编写程序,从键盘输入三个整数,求这三个整数的最大值和最小值

#include<stdio.h>

intmain()
{
inta,b,c;
scanf("%d%d%d",&a,&b,&c);
printf("MAXIS[%d]MINIS[%d] ",a>b?a:b>c?b:c,a<b?a:b<c?b:c);
return1;
}
321
MAXIS[3]MINIS[1]
Pressanykeytocontinue

㈦ 3个数求最大值 最小值 用C语言 求改错

if(a>b)
{
if(b>c)
printf("最大值=%d",a);
printf("最小值=%c\n",c);
else
{if(a>c)
printf("最大值=%d",a);
printf("最小值=%c\n",b);
else
printf("最大值=%d",c);
printf("最小值=%c\n",b);
}
你前面已经a>b了,下面就只判断c,有a>c,a
c,b
c能确定最大值和最小值,另外两个还要再比一次,所以这里就错了,下面就不说了
设两个数int
max
,min再进行比较,大的赋给max,小的赋给min
1.
ab比
得到max
min
2.
c和max比
if(c>max)max=c;
else{if(c
评论
0
0
加载更多

㈧ c语言中怎样求三个数中的最小值

输入三个数,编写一个程序求这三个数的最大值和最小值,要求把求最大值和最小值编写成函数。

㈨ C语言求输入三个数输出最大与最小值

求最小值同理即可